[Daemon] outputfiles gets truncated on startup

           Summary: [Daemon] outputfiles gets truncated on startup
           Product: Commons
           Version: 1.0 Alpha
          Platform: Other
        OS/Version: Linux
            Status: NEW
          Severity: Minor
          Priority: Other
         Component: Daemon
        AssignedTo: commons-dev@jakarta.apache.org
        ReportedBy: noa@resare.com


Annoying for debugging, the files passed as -outfile or -errfile arguments to
jsvc gets truncated when jsvc starts up.

Apart from being annoying this is inconsistent with the behaviour of other tools.
